Which of the following is NOT required for a green plant to carry out photosynthesis?

A Oxygen
B Water
C Light energy
D Carbon dioxide
Show Worked Solution

Worked Solution

Step 1: Recall the word equation for photosynthesis: Carbon Dioxide + Water (in the presence of light and chlorophyll) → Sugar + Oxygen. Step 2: Oxygen is a product, not a requirement. Step 3: Plants take in CO2 and water to make food.

Correct answer: Oxygen
